Transaction 58a4d43f286c3aa9ccff54709d79a3a213ccb76dc5b41fa5d6d5944a9657c445
1 Input
2 Outputs
- 58a4d43f286c3aa9ccff54709d79a3a213ccb76dc5b41fa5d6d5944a9657c445:0
- 58a4d43f286c3aa9ccff54709d79a3a213ccb76dc5b41fa5d6d5944a9657c445:1
value 1528521
address 3Pfp4hMhaihEuUxhQmznKuWrDFVhDYhTC2
value 22643668
address 1JULrMT4yqs2r5AR5ZTSYHtaNtXSHQFP1m